Civil War Period Polish St. Stanislaus Shield - with Gold Gilt Madonna and Child This lot features a rare Polish St. Stanislaus Shield from the Civil War period, beautifully adorned with a gold gilt Madonna and Child. The shield is an exquisite example of Polish Catholic symbolism, showcasing the reverence for St. Stanislaus, the patron saint of Poland. The gold gilt rendering of the Madonna and Child adds an element of artistry and devotion, making this piece not only a historic relic but also a stunning work of craftsmanship. This shield likely served as a personal or religious symbol during the tumultuous Civil War era, providing a tangible connection to both Polish heritage and Catholic faith. The item's condition and intricate details make it a valuable addition to any collection of religious or military artifacts from the 19th century.
